Longfield Hall is really excited to have the wonderful String Theatre back for the third time with their family show The Red Balloon.

Saturday 15 December 4.30pm

Sunday 16 December 11am and 4.30pm

The Red Balloon tells the story of a small boy's friendship with a balloon. Using long-string wood-carved marionettes and accompanied by specially commissioned music, this spell-binding show transports both adults and children into the poignant world of the puppet characters. Age guide 3+

Tickets ?9/?5

Running time 45 minutes.
